WebbFigure 8-37 shows a cross section of a thin cylindrical pressure vessel reinforced with stringers. The axial stress in the shell is. Fmmer = pr 2t (bt + 2μAst bt + Ast) (8-22) and that in the stringer is. Fstmer = pr 2t (bt(1 − 2μ) bt + Ast) (8-23) The circumferential stress is the same as that in a simple thin cylinder. Fmt = pr t. WebbStringer: is a special strake of the Strength Deck plating. It is the strake that connects the Strength Deck to the Side Shell. Strength Deck: is a special deck. Webb16 jan. 2024 · Strakes of bottom plating to the bilges have their greatest thickness over 40 per cent of the ship's length amidships, where the bending stresses are highest. The bottom plating then tapers to a lesser thickness at the ends of the ship, apart from increased thickness requirements in way of the pounding region (see Chapter 16).
